How We Handle Your Data

End-to-end protection from the moment your data enters our pipeline to the moment it leaves.

Data in Transit

TLS 1.3 encryption on all API connections. Your email list never travels unencrypted.

Data at Rest

Encryption at rest. Infrastructure locations and transfer safeguards are documented in the Privacy Policy and DPA.

Data Retention

Bulk job results kept 90 days then permanently deleted. Single-check results purged after 24 hours.

GDPR & Privacy Compliance

BounceZero Ltd is a UK registered company (No. 17153835) operating under UK GDPR. We act as a data processor when verifying your contact lists.

We do not sell, share, or use your email data for any purpose other than verification. Your data is yours - we just tell you which addresses are real.

Infrastructure Security

Multiple layers of protection across every component of our stack.

API Authentication

Bearer token auth. API keys are SHA-256 hashed in the database.

Rate Limiting

Per-endpoint rate limits prevent abuse and protect your account.

Webhook Signatures

HMAC-SHA256 signed payloads. Verify every webhook delivery.

No Plaintext Storage

Email addresses in bulk jobs are never logged to disk.

Audit Logging

All credential reveals and sensitive actions are audit-logged.

How BounceZero Support Contacts You

Attackers impersonate support teams. These rules never change, so you can always tell the difference.

We will never ask you for any of these

  • Your password, on any channel, for any reason.
  • A support PIN, verification code, or two-factor code.
  • Your API key. We can see what we need without it, and we can issue you a new one.
  • Card numbers or full billing details over chat or email.
  • Access to a different account, or credentials belonging to a colleague.
  • Remote access to your machine, or installation of any software.

Every ticket lives in your dashboard

If we have an open case with you, you can see it signed in to your account. A conversation that exists only in your inbox or a chat window is not from us.

A reference number proves nothing

Anyone can invent a case ID and quote it to you. Verify it the other way round: sign in and look for the ticket yourself. If it is not there, the request is not ours.

We only email from bouncezero.io

Our mail is SPF, DKIM and DMARC authenticated. Check the sending domain, not the display name — a display name costs an attacker nothing to fake.

Urgency is the tell

Warnings that your domain, account or email is at risk unless you act immediately are pressure tactics. Nothing we need from you is ever time-critical in that way.

Contacted by someone claiming to be BounceZero support? Forward it to [email protected] and do not reply to them.
